Foundation Structural Repair in Swansea, MA
Foundation structural rep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including addressing cracked or bowing walls, uneven floors, settling or sinking foundations, and other signs of foundation movement. Property owners often seek these repairs after noticing symptoms such as visible cracks, doors or windows that stick, or gaps between walls and floors, which can indicate underlying problems that may worsen over time if left unaddressed.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, potential causes, and the best methods for stabilization or reinforcement. It’s important to evaluate whether the foundation issues are due to soil movement, water intrusion, or structural failure. Proper assessment can help determine the most suitable repair approach, whether it involves underpinning, piering, or other stabilization techniques, to ensure the long-term safety and stability of the property.

Common Foundation Structural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Underpinning services - stabilizes and raises sinking or uneven foundations.
Pier and beam repair - restores support for homes with pier and beam foundations.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to reduce foundation movement.
Basement wall reinforcement - prevents bowing or collapsing basement walls.
Drainage correction - manages water flow to protect foundations from water damage.
Foundation Structural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ues? Visible cracks in walls, uneven flooring, and sticking doors or windows may indicate foundation problems.
What causes foundation settlement? Factors like soil movement, poor drainage, and moisture changes can lead to foundation settling or shifting.
How is foundation damage repaired? Repairs often involve underpinning, stabilization, or piering to restore stability and support to the structure.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but larger or expanding cracks should be evaluated by a professional.
